The mixed number 162 4/7 written as an improper fraction is 1138/7
To turn the mixed number 162 4/7 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:
First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 162 × 7 = 1134.
After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 1134 + 4 = 1138.
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 1138/7.
This means that 162 4/7, as an improper fraction, equals 1138/7.
